Core Technical Specifications
At the heart of this battery’s appeal is its 48V voltage output, a standard that balances energy density and efficiency for modern e-bike applications. With a 12.8Ah capacity, it provides sufficient range for daily commutes or extended recreational rides. The battery utilizes high-quality 18650 lithium-ion cells, a widely trusted format known for durability and consistent discharge rates.

Key metrics include:

  • Voltage: 48V
  • Capacity: 12.8Ah
  • Max Discharge Current: 30A (via integrated BMS)
  • Weight: 3.2 kg (7.05 lbs)
  • Dimensions: 430mm x 100mm x 43mm (16.93” x 3.94” x 1.69”)
  • Compatibility: 350W, 500W, 750W, and 1000W motors
  • Charging Time: 6–7 hours with a 54.6V 2A charger

The battery’s 30A battery management system (BMS) ensures stable performance by safeguarding against overcharging, over-discharging, short circuits, and voltage fluctuations. This level of protection is critical for extending cycle life, which the manufacturer estimates at 800–1,000 cycles (approximately 3–5 years under moderate use).


Design and Durability
Crafted for folding e-bikes, the DCH-006 features a streamlined, built-in design that integrates seamlessly with frames to maintain portability. Its ABS plastic and aluminum alloy casing strikes a balance between lightweight construction and ruggedness, ideal for urban environments where shocks and vibrations are common.

A notable highlight is its IP65 water-resistant rating, which allows riders to confidently navigate light rain or wet roads. While prolonged exposure to moisture is not advised, the encapsulation of internal components ensures short-term resilience against splashes and humidity.

The dual-function locking mechanism adds both security and practicality:

  1. A physical lock secures the battery within the bike frame, deterring theft.
  2. The same key acts as a power switch, requiring riders to turn it fully to activate the battery before riding. This design prevents accidental activation and ensures the key remains engaged during operation.

Safety and Longevity
Safety is paramount in lithium-ion systems, and the DCH-006’s BMS excels here. The multi-layered protections—overcharge, over-discharge, short circuit, and temperature monitoring—prevent catastrophic failures. Riders in hotter climates have noted the battery’s resilience to heat buildup during summer rides, a testament to its robust thermal management.

To maximize lifespan, the manufacturer recommends:

  • Avoiding full discharges (aim for 20–80% charge cycles when possible).
  • Storing the battery in a cool, dry environment during extended inactivity.
  • Using only the provided 54.6V charger to prevent voltage mismatches.
